Intelligent Sensing, On-Demand Application: The Technological Transformation of Agricultural Sprayers

Release time: 2025-11-12 14:01:37

Contemporary agricultural sprayers are undergoing a profound intelligent transformation, shifting from ‘uniform spraying’ towards ‘sensing and precision application’. This evolution is primarily driven by two major technological systems.

First is the sensing and decision-making system. Equipped with high-definition cameras and specific spectral sensors, sprayers can scan and identify crops and weeds in real-time while in motion. Artificial intelligence algorithms instantly assess weed distribution and density, generating precise application instructions. Secondly, the precision execution system replaces traditional constant-flow nozzles with individually controlled solenoid valves. These valves activate or deactivate within milliseconds to target individual weeds based on received commands. This ‘spray only where detected’ approach eliminates pesticide wastage on bare ground or healthy crops entirely.

The benefits of this technological transformation are manifold and substantial. For farmers, the most immediate impact is a significant reduction in pesticide costs, with savings typically ranging from 30% to 50%. From an environmental perspective, it substantially reduces pesticide residues in soil and water bodies, aligning with the direction of green agriculture. Simultaneously, as the spray solution is applied more precisely to target objects, its weed control efficacy is more thorough.
